Havant and South Downs College plays leading role in promoting sport for disabled students
The hub represents a select group of colleges committed to making sport and physical activity inclusive for disabled students.
They will engage students in sport and physical activity, recruit Inclusive Ambassadors and host local development opportunities for other colleges in their area. HSDC was one of only 12 colleges selected.
